>Yes it is. I'm running Oracle 7.3.3 and Oracle 8.0.5 on the same server box
>and access both databases from the same client. I can access both databases
>using SQLPlus 3 and SQLPlus 8.
>
>I believe the rule is SQLPlus 3 uses SQLNET and SQLPlus 8 uses NET8 so you
>will need to add the same entry to both tnsnames files and run listeners
for
>both databases in NET8 and SQLNET.
